Liverpool Plotting Move For Two Juventus Stars Worth Over £100M

Jürgen Klopp’s side are reportedly seeking to bring in two Juventus talents before the end of the transfer window

Jürgen Klopp’s side are reportedly seeking to bring in two Juventus talents with a combined valuation of £102.8M before the end of the transfer window, according to Gazetta Dello Sport

Long-term target Matthijs de Ligt looks to be on the move this summer, and Liverpool don’t want to miss out on the opportunity to sign the Chelsea and Bayern Munich transfer target.

Meanwhile, the Reds are also eyeing up Adrien Rabiot, whose Juventus contract expires next summer, to reinforce their midfield options.

The Matthjis de Ligt story is an interesting one.

Liverpool are well covered in central defence and don’t especially need a new centre-back.


Klopp can already pick from the likes of Virgil Van Dijk, Ibrahima Konaté, Joel Matip, and Joe Gomez.

Gomez’s role has grown more sporadic in recent times, and some reports suggested he could leave the Anfield club this summer, but the latest signs point towards him signing a new deal with Liverpool.

With no indication Liverpool are looking to sell Van Dijk, Matip, or Konaté alongside tying down Gomez to a new deal, a move for de Ligt would be strange.

However, the Dutchman is a hugely talented defender, and could be viewed as Van Dijk’s natural successor at Liverpool.

Klopp's side therefore may not want to miss out on signing him if he is available this summer.

As for Rabiot, as more of a deep lying playmaker, he’d provide good competition for Thiago Alcantara in Liverpool’s engine room.


However, Liverpool are unlikely to be legitimately interested in signing the Frenchman.

After all, Juventus are said to be interested in Roberto Firmino, who Liverpool could be open to selling, but the Reds aren’t interested in including Rabiot in any kind of swap deal.

With The Mirror reporting Liverpool aren’t interested in bringing in any more new signings this summer, these rumours are unlikely to materialise into anything serious.
